IN LOVING MEMORY OF
Roberta Ann
Mislevy
December 15, 1953 – November 16, 2022
Roberta "Robbie" Mislevy, 68, formerly of Lawrenceville, New Jersey, and Waterman, Illinois, passed November 16, 2022, in Severna Park, Maryland. Robbie was born December 15, 1953, to Harry Jr. "Bob" and Janet Bronson.
Robbie graduated from Waterman High School in 1972 and played softball for Waterman and the DeKalb County Farm Bureau, winning two state Farm Bureau Championships. She obtained a Bachelor of Science degree from Northern Illinois University, where she met her husband, Robert J." Bob" Mislevy in 1973. They had two beautiful daughters, Jessica and Meredith. Robbie's greatest joys were her children and grandchildren.
Robbie was an accomplished musician, playing the piano, flute, French horn, and tympani. She often accompanied several choral groups on the piano, including the Waterman Methodist Junior Choir and her father Bob when he sang. Robbie studied piano with internationally known pianist and piano professor Donald Walker at Northern Illinois University.
While in Illinois, Robbie worked for Proctor and Gamble as a sales representative, and managed Townhouse Books in St. Charles then the Persimmon Tree gourmet food store in Geneva. After moving to Lawrenceville, New Jersey, in 1984, she established Forget-Me-Not Antiques and operated from co-ops in Hopewell and Lambertville and played in several softball and volleyball leagues.
After organizing book fairs for the students at Benjamin Franklin Elementary School where her daughters attended, Robbie became a library aide there. She went on to obtain a graduate teaching certificate at Rider University and taught second grade for five years at Ben Franklin. She then become a technology teacher for the Lawrence Township district's elementary teachers, to help bring a modern learning experience to children in the classroom.
Robbie was an avid photographer. Robbie and Bob's travel in the US and Europe led to several of her photographs receiving juried prizes and honors. The National Parks were favorite locations for landscapes and animal photographs. A yearly calendar of her photographs was a cherished family gift.
Robbie is survived by her husband Robert "Bob" Mislevy of Severna Park, Maryland; her children Jessica Mislevy (Rémi) of Washington, DC, Meredith (Zachary) Hughes and two grandsons Alex and Elliot Hughes of Annapolis, Maryland; sister Debra "Debbie" Bronson of Irving, Texas, brother Robert Jay "Butch" Bronson of Riverview, Florida; niece Cassara Bronson and grandnephews Rhyan, Reid and Remi of Wesley Chapel, Florida; brother-in-law and sister-in-law Richard and Cynthia Mislevy of Bartlett, Illinois; and, nieces Lea Ann Mislevy of Chicago, Illinois, and Lorin Mislevy of Bartlett, Illinois. Robbie was preceded in death by her parents.
